All real (I say real becaue there is so much junk on the market) motorcycle jackets should have the sleeve end above the wrist. That is to yield maximum freedom of motion. The full gauntlet gloves are your choice if you want to be full covered for protection and to prevent wind from entering the sleeve and your jacket acting as Funny-Car-Style air drag brake.

The gloves you have (I have some of them too) are good for city riding where you want as much ventilation around the wrists. That is the prime spot for cooling your entire body.

Racing gloves have the gauntlet that deflects the wind but also retain that freedom of mobility at the wrist area.

I'd also like to congratulate you on choosing the right size jacket. Way too many people choose one and often two sized too big. It is supposed to be tight and not really allow for a badmutherfukker sagging look or the ability to fit a big sweater.
